I'm into photography and one of the hard to get lens (Nikon 18-200mm VR lens) have been selling for a premium since the beginning of 2006. Well, last August, I decided to see if I could could make a profit selling these lenses. Actually I just wanted to make enough profit to help pay for one of those lenses to keep for myself. I'd order a few of these lenses at $750 each, wait about two months or so for them to arrive, and then sell them for much higher price on Ebay....I was hooked. I pretty much made it a side business, so long as there's demand. I've sold roughly 130 of these babies. My "Buy-It-Now" price was as high as $949 around Christmas time, but the demand is dropping and they are currently listed at $849.
